01. How a Steam Eye Mask Works

A steam eye mask works by using heat and moisture to relax the muscles and increase blood circulation in the eye area. The mask is placed over the eyes and a warm steam is applied, which helps to open up the pores and improve circulation. This increased blood flow brings more oxygen and nutrients to the area, reducing puffiness and bags under the eyes.

02. Benefits of Using a Steam Eye Mask

Reduces Puffiness: By increasing blood flow to the eye area, a steam eye mask can help reduce puffiness and bags under the eyes.

Lightens Dark Circles: Improved circulation can help reduce the appearance of dark circles around the eyes, making you look more rested and refreshed.

Relaxes Muscles: The heat and moisture from the steam can relax the muscles around the eyes, reducing tension and strain.

Improves Circulation: By increasing blood flow to the eye area, a steam eye mask can improve overall circulation, which can benefit other areas of your body as well.

Easy to Use: Steam eye masks are easy to use and can be worn while relaxing or sleeping, making it an ideal treatment for reducing puffiness and dark circles.

03. Using a Steam Eye Mask

To use a steam eye mask, simply follow these steps:

Cleanse your face and remove any makeup around the eyes.

Place the steam eye mask over your eyes, making sure it covers the area comfortably.

Apply warm steam to the mask using a steamer or by placing it over a bowl of hot water.

Relax with the mask on for 10-15 minutes, allowing the heat and moisture to work its magic.

Remove the mask and pat your eyes dry with a soft towel.

Apply your usual eye cream or treatment to further hydrate and nourish the area.

Remember to use a steam eye mask as directed and be careful not to use too much heat to avoid burning or discomfort. If you have any questions or concerns, consult a healthcare professional before using a steam eye mask.
